The Marc Jacobs Tweet Shop is coming to Amsterdam

Good news for Daisy fans! The Marc Jacobs Tweet shop is coming to de Bijenkorf in Amsterdam for the promotion of the new women fragrance Marc Jacobs Daisy Dream, as I read on the website of de Bijenkorf. In this shop you don’t pay for the items in euro’s but with tweets. With tweets? Yes, with tweets. All you have to do is send at least one tweet with the hashtag #MJDaisyChainAMS while in the shop. I Love SU fashion line at Dresscode in Paramaribo

IMG-20140205-02198

The I love.. shirts are a fashion phenomenon and nowadays has become an integral part of casual street wear around the world. Most of you know the many I <3.. shirts of different cities like A’DAM, Berlin, London, Paris, Milan, Roma, Barcelona, Stockholm, NY, LA, Miami, Montreal, Tokyo and so on. In Suriname, where I’m from, there is the I Love SU fashion line and merchandise. While I’m not here to explain to you the history and demographics of Suriname, I can tell you that the population is not even close to one million citizens. Most people live in the capital city Paramaribo, and when there is talk about life in Suriname or going to Suriname it usually is about Paramaribo, but in general people speak of Su (short for Suriname). It is not like, for example, the United States or Spain (because of the big cities), that there is a I Love.. clothing line for almost every city. No, in small populated Suriname, like I said, they speak of Su. That is basically the history behind the choice of the name I Love SU.
